IT Spending: Top Down vs. Decentralized Decision Making

Fifty-three percent of IT leaders made significant changes to their IT operating model or organization in the last two years, and another 37 percent are in the process of making changes according to the aforementioned survey.

The Software Budget’s Appetite Kept in Check by the Bottom Line

Application support consumes more internal labor spend than application development on average, despite generally higher salaries for application developers than for support personnel.
